5
правок
Изменения
Нет описания правки
'''Теорема''' <tex>3SAT \in NPC </tex>, ''т.е. задача о выполнимости булевой формулы в форме 3-КНФ <tex>NP</tex>-полна.''
'''Доказательство'''
Для того, чтобы доказать <tex>NP</tex>-полноту задачи, необходимо установить следующие факты:
# <tex> 3SAT \in NPH </tex>;
# <tex> 3SAT \in NP </tex>.
Установим сначала первый факт, то есть <tex>NP</tex>-трудность <tex>3SAT</tex>.
Для этого покажем, что <tex>CNFSAT \le 3SAT</tex>, то есть <tex>CNFSAT</tex> сводится по Куку к <tex>3SAT</tex>.